For my hids, i put a piece of 1/4 in fire wire glass in my cab top to seal the heat in, got it from a glass shop. (1/4 in plexi glass would work also)
Then i bought a cheepo bathroom vent fan for 15$ to pull out the hot air.

The 150w hps isnt that hot of a bulb, i can screw it out with my bare hand. (the MH 175 is way hotter)
My old cab full of CFL was just about as hot as my HID cab.
 
yeah cfl's give more heat less light per watt. i think you have enough fan power, make sure to make oassive intake holes big enough for air to enter freely from bottom of room
